> This patch removes plexus-webdav in favor of Jackrabbit's webdav servlet
> implementation. It is not yet 100% completed and tested. HTTP GET and PUT
> should work correctly.
> The following needs to happen before integration:
> 1) New Jackrabbit classes need to be correctly unit tested.
> 2) Webdav properties need to be implemented
> 3) Testing of common webdav clients - Mac OS X, Windows, Wagon-Dav, etc
